When cold receptors adapt, they become less responsive to continual cold stimulation. This adaptation helps the body maintain a balance in temperature perception and prevents sensory overload. It allows the body to focus on new, changing stimuli rather than constantly signaling the presence of cold.

When your body gets cold, blood vessels near the skin's surface constrict to conserve heat, causing your body temperature to drop. The body may shiver to generate heat, and metabolism increases to help maintain core temperature. Prolonged exposure to cold can lead to hypothermia, where the body loses heat faster than it can produce it.
Hypothermia is a condition that has the potential to affect everyone. This is a condition that happens when the body gets too cold for too long.
